On this remarkable occasion of Sri Lanka’s 77th Independence Day, I extend my deepest congratulations to the beautiful nation of Sri Lanka. Today is a day of reflection, pride, and renewal as we remember the courage, sacrifice, and unity that led to our freedom.


As we celebrate this significant milestone, I am reminded that true independence is not just the freedom from external forces, but also the strength to rise above our divisions and unite as one people, under one flag. Sri Lanka is a land rich in diversity—home to various ethnicities, languages, and most beautifully, multiple religions. This diversity is our strength, and it is through mutual respect, understanding, and love for one another that we can create a nation that stands as a beacon of peace, unity, and prosperity.


As we move forward into the future, let us remember the timeless values of compassion, forgiveness, and respect that form the foundation of my Christian faith. We also reminisce on how Calvary bought freedom to the Christian through Christ's death and resurrection, and we pray that all of Sri Lanka experiences the same.


On this 77th Independence Day, may the spirit of unity and reconciliation shine brighter than ever before. May God bless Sri Lanka abundantly with peace, love, and enduring unity.
